Facilities
Clubhouse with changing rooms, bars, restaurants, apartments and a fully stocked pro shop. Golf facilities include a pitching green, putting green and driving range. Trolley and buggy hire available.
Description

Designed by Robert Trent Jones in 1975 Valderrama is a 6356 metres par 71 with no hole of less than championship quality but it can be fully enjoyed by players of all handicaps, thanks to the genius of Robert Trent Jones, Senior, whom many consider the leading golf architect of his day. 


Lush tree lined fairways and immaculate elevated greens give this course the recognition it so deserves.  All shots need accuracy and good distance judgment and the strategic difficult, omnipresent trees, the size of the bunkers and a few water hazards keep the player constantly on his wits for every stroke. The pressure is made worse when it comes to reading the greens. Don't bother about playing to your handicap, as even the top champions find making par a tough enough challenge at Valderrama.

The 17th hole on Valderrama is named 'Las Gabiones'. It is also the most talked about hole on the course. Remodelled by Seve Ballesteros and measuring 455 metres from the Championship tees, it has been the scene of many dramatic moments during the Ryder Cup, and in the World Championship events.

Visitors are welcome with some restriction on tee times.
